Two worshippers injured in Khulna mosque shooting


Published: 01:40 14 June 2026
Two people were injured in a shooting by terrorists after Fajr prayers at a mosque in Daulatpur area of Khulna city. The incident that occurred early Sunday morning has created concern and excitement in the area.
According to local information, worshippers were staying inside the mosque after prayers. At that time, some armed men entered the mosque and opened fire. Two people named Lokman and Alam were shot.
Eyewitnesses said that Lokman, one of the injured, was reciting the Quran after prayers. Suddenly, the attackers opened fire on him, spreading panic among the worshippers present in the mosque.
Later, locals rescued the injured and admitted them to Khulna Medical College Hospital. According to doctors, Lokman's condition is serious and he has been sent to Dhaka for advanced treatment. The other injured Alam is currently undergoing treatment at the hospital.
After receiving the information, the police reached the spot and started an investigation. Local residents have expressed anger over such attacks on religious places of worship and have demanded the immediate arrest of those involved.
Police said that work is underway to uncover the cause of the incident. It is being investigated whether there is a personal dispute, dominance or any other motive behind the attack. The operation is ongoing to identify those involved and bring them to justice.
